#a6ea3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6ea3e is composed of 65.1% red, 91.8%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 83.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 58%. #a6ea3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#4dd500.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#a6ea3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6ea3e has RGB values of R:166, G:234,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 10938942.

Shades and Tints of #a6ea3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f8fdef is the lightest one.
